CAS 5399-03-1: 2-Iodo-1-methoxy-4-nitrobenzene

Formula:C7H6INO3
InChI:InChI=1S/C7H6INO3/c1-12-7-3-2-5(9(10)11)4-6(7)8/h2-4H,1H3
InChI key:InChIKey=KBQBNJHOTNIGDD-UHFFFAOYSA-N
SMILES:N(=O)(=O)C1=CC(I)=C(OC)C=C1
Synonyms:
  • 1-Iodo-2-methoxy-5-nitrobenzene
  • 2-Iodo-1-Methoxy-4-Nitrobenzene
  • 3-Iodo-4-(methoxy)nitrobenzene
  • 3-Iodo-4-methoxy-1-nitrobenzene
  • Anisole, 2-iodo-4-nitro-
  • Benzene, 2-iodo-1-methoxy-4-nitro-
  • Nsc 3739
  • 2-Iodo-4-nitroanisole
